Understanding Cold Laser Treatment



To recognize cold laser treatment, you should realize the fundamental concepts of just how this non-invasive treatment approach functions. Cold laser treatment, also referred to as low-level laser therapy (LLLT), involves the use of low-intensity laser light to boost recovery at the mobile degree. This sort of treatment is frequently made use of to minimize swelling, minimize discomfort, and advertise cells fixing in numerous problems.


During a cold laser therapy session, a trained health care expert will apply the laser gadget directly to the skin in the afflicted area. The light energy produced by the laser passes through the skin and is taken in by the cells, where it's exchanged biochemical power. This energy helps to stimulate mobile processes, increase circulation, and reduce inflammation, causing pain relief and increased recovery.

Cold laser treatment is a secure and pain-free treatment alternative that can be made use of alone or in combination with other therapies to handle chronic discomfort effectively.

Mechanism of Pain Relief



Understanding the system of pain alleviation in cold laser treatment entails understanding exactly how low-intensity laser light interacts with cellular procedures to reduce pain. When the cold laser is applied to the skin, it penetrates the cells and is soaked up by the mitochondria within the cells. This absorption sets off a collection of responses that cause enhanced production of adenosine triphosphate (ATP), the energy currency of the cell.

The enhanced ATP production enhances mobile feature, including faster tissue repair work and reduced swelling.
